I turned on my radio on Tuesday morning to hear the one voice that,
foolishly, I hoped would remain silent after Thursday's bombs: the
BNP's Nick Griffin, being interviewed on the Today programme.
Griffin was in top form, arguing that the problem with Muslims is their
text, which is a book of violence. What might come as a shock to the
BNP faithful is that Griffin's reasoning comes straight out of the
al-Qaida manual. This is the equivalent of running a key-word search
through the Qur'an; hunting for sentences that contain words such as
"infidel", "war" or "violence"; and then reproducing these sentences on
websites to declare that Islam equals violence. Not one Muslim
commentator I know has bothered to tackle this issue with the forensic
detail it demands.
